HONEY LIME ENCHILADAS

6 Tablespoons Honey
5 Tablespoons Lime (about 2 limes)
1 Tablespoon Chili Powder
1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
1 pound chicken, cooked and shredded (I used 4 chicken breasts)
10 tortillas
1 pound Monterey Jack Cheese, shredded
16 ounce green chili enchilada sauce
1 cup heavy cream

Mix the 1st 4 ingredients together and toss with chicken.
Marinade 1/2 hour.
Pour 1/2 cup enchilada sauce on the bottom of a 9x13 baking pan.
Fill tortillas with chicken and cheese
(save some cheese for the top)
Mix the remaining enchilada sauce with the cream and the leftover marinade and pour on top of tortillas and sprinkle with cheese.
Bake at 350 degrees for 30 minutes.
